Social Influence, Power, and Multimodal Communication reveals how democratic leaders and dictators exploit multimodal communication to convince or seduce their audiences, using words, voice, gesture, face, gaze, and posture to boast about their merits or insult and ridicule rivals. Poggi and D'Errico explore questions such as what is charisma, and how do we perceive it in a leader? And how do politicians display their dominance over opponents, or discredit them in TV debates and social media? Starting from a sociocognitive model of social interaction, observational studies reveal the rhetoric of words, hands, and faces, explaining how to see beyond their literal meanings, while experimental studies test their uses and persuasive effects. The authors affirm that multimodality helps others to influence us through displays of dominance, and by undermining our power through comments, insults, irony, ridicule, and parody. The devices of social influence and its multimodal management are illuminated, giving readers insight into how people influence others' lives by using body language and verbal communication, either explicitly or in subtle but inexorable ways. Tanya Calamoneri, Assistant Professor, The Ohio State University, author of Butoh America In Experimental Dance and the Somatics of Language, Nicely investigates the use of language in dance practice by considering the somatics of micromovement in three phases vibration, interval, and adaptation. Nicely's ingenious move, after Deleuze, is to give language a body on the dance floor. Language, reconfigured as a source of sensation, becomes a critical analytic tool for Nicely to think through dance works past and present, contributing to performance studies ongoing inquiry into how speech acts. Melinda Buckwalter, Managing Director, Five College Dance, author of Composing while Dancing This book is about dances relationship to language. It investigates how dance bodies work with the micromovements elicited by languages affective forces, and the micropolitics of the thought-sensations that arise when movement and words accompany one another within choreographic contexts. Situating itself where theory meets practicethe zone where ideas arise to be tested, the book draws on embodied research in practices within the lineages of American postmodern dance and Japanese butoh, set in dialog with affect-based philosophies and somatics. Understanding that language is felt, both when uttered and when unspoken, this book speaks to the choreographic thinking that takes place when language is considered a primary element in creating the sensorium. Megan V. Nicely is an artist/scholar whose research involves choreographic experimentation through the medium of the body. She has published in TDR, Choreographic Practices, Performance Research Journal, and others, and her company Megan Nicely/Dance has performed on both U.S. coasts, in the U.K., and in Europe. She is Associate Professor of Performing Arts and Social Justice/Dance at University of San Francisco.

Des contributions sur le concept du non narratif au théâtre, qui correspond à des pièces où rien ne se passe. Les réflexions incluent des parallèles entre la théâtralité, la littérarité et la dramaticité, et convoquent des concepts comme l'épicisation ou le théâtre rhapsodique. Les cas du théâtre d'objet, du théâtre d'images et du théâtre peint sont traités. ©Electre 2023 L'Histoire du théâtre est le tressage des histoires qu'il a su représenter depuis le fonds mythologique jusqu'au théâtre moderne. La présence de l'intrigue, l'action, le muthos et la fable en sont la parfaite illustration. Etudier le concept du non narratif au théâtre présuppose un retour à la généalogie du récit au théâtre, pour voir ses origines, son développement et son devenir. L'interrogation fédératrice de notre essai est le comment du fonctionnement de ce théâtre qui ne raconte rien, un théâtre où rien ne se passe.La réflexion porte ainsi sur les parallèles entre théâtralité, littérarité et dramaticité et sur le concept du non narratif dans ses rapports avec l'hybridité et l'intersemiosité, ce qui a généré des formes diverses à l'image du théâtre d'objet, du théâtre d'images, du théâtre peint. Bref, un théâtre post-narratif où la narration devient objet d'analyse. A l'intérieur de ce paradigme, nous avons convoqué des concepts comme l'épicisation selon P.Szondi, ou le théâtre rapsodique de J. P. Sarrazac, tout comme le monologue et ses nouvelles fonctions.

En pleine épidémie de Covid, dans une maternité déserte, je me suis demandé si mon fils allait naître dans un monde irrémédiablement appauvri, sans le droit de se toucher ni de se rencontrer. Le confinement a été levé, mon fils est né, mais les « gestes barrières » sont restés. J’ai découvert l’immense continent des gestes de la maternité, tour à tour libérateurs et aliénants. J’ai alors commencé à réfléchir aux architectures tactiles, celles qui nous entravent et celles qui nous portent, et à imaginer une archéologie du toucher. L’amour et la perte, la tendresse et la violence, la transmission et la rupture, la naissance et la mort : et si l’on racontait notre vie sous l’angle des gestes qui la composent ? Des mains heureuses qui nous font et nous défont ?
